Berco's, Asian restaurant in National Capital Region, India
Berco's is an Asian restaurant that serves dumplings, noodles, curries, and stir-fried dishes using traditional cooking techniques from across the continent. The menu combines classic preparation methods and ingredients drawn from different regional cuisines.
The restaurant started in 1982 and grew into an established chain with locations across India. This growth over the decades shows how Asian cuisine became rooted in the region's dining culture.
The restaurant brings together different Asian cooking traditions, from Burmese Khao Suey to Thai curries and Chinese Sichuan preparations that visitors can taste in one place. This blend reflects how diverse regional flavors meet and complement each other on the menu.
The restaurant offers both dining at tables and delivery services that bring food directly home. The kitchen operates to recognized food safety standards, ensuring reliable meals.
The restaurant specializes in dumplings filled with spinach, cheese, and corn, as well as chicken versions served with burnt chili oil. These handmade creations stand out through their flavor combinations from standard offerings elsewhere.
